Santa Cruz County Residents for Clean Water Fire Safety And Climate Resilience

Based in Sacramento, CA, Santa Cruz County Residents for Clean Water Fire Safety And Climate Resilience operates as a Public Charity. The organization reported $400K in revenue, $114K in expenses, $286K in total assets for fiscal year 2023. Imperigo tracks 1 reported grant relationships connected to this organization totaling approximately $25K.

Mission

Ballot measure for Santa Cruz County in California aimed at safeguarding water quality, preserving clean ocean and beach areas, reducing wildfire risks, protecting forests, enhancing wildlife habitats, and improving community spaces.
